A concrete jungle is probably the most referred cliché of the overall impression of Hong Kong cityscape. Yet, indeed 66% of Hong Kong territory consists of woodland. With its historical inheritance, special geology, unique urban fabric & recent social values, the city’s existing greenery was being preserved and new greenery fusing with its built environment is starting to flourish. This exhibit aims to dig out Hong Kong’s greenery amidst the built environment with terrarium / bonsai as a media of dialogue, putting forth a fresh perspective to the audience of what Hong Kong’s urban space & its greenery is about, penetrating the past, present and future, in particular those of the Tsuen Wan District at this exhibition at The Mills.
